Understanding the Basics: What is an Online Casino?
An online casino is essentially a virtual platform that replicates the experience of a traditional brick-and-mortar casino. Instead of physically visiting a casino, you access these platforms through your computer, smartphone, or tablet. They offer a wide array of casino games, including pokies (slots), blackjack, roulette, poker, and many more. These games are typically powered by software providers that ensure fairness and randomness through the use of Random Number Generators (RNGs). This technology ensures that the outcome of each game is unpredictable and unbiased, providing a level playing field for all players.
Choosing a Reputable Online Casino: Your First Step
The online casino market is vast, and not all platforms are created equal. Choosing a reputable and trustworthy online casino is the most crucial step for a beginner. Here are some key factors to consider:
- Licensing and Regulation: Look for casinos licensed by reputable regulatory bodies, such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), or the Curacao eGaming. These licenses indicate that the casino adheres to strict standards of fairness, security, and responsible gambling. Check the casino’s website for its licensing information, usually found in the footer.
- Security: Ensure the casino uses robust security measures, such as SSL encryption, to protect your personal and financial information. Look for the padlock symbol in the browser’s address bar, indicating a secure connection.
- Game Selection: A good online casino offers a diverse selection of games from reputable software providers. This ensures a variety of options and fair gameplay.
- Payment Options: Check if the casino supports convenient and secure payment methods for Australians, such as credit/debit cards, bank transfers, e-wallets (e.g., PayPal, Neteller, Skrill), and potentially even cryptocurrencies.
- Customer Support: Reliable customer support is essential. Look for casinos that offer 24/7 support via live chat, email, or phone.
- Bonuses and Promotions: While bonuses can be attractive, always read the terms and conditions carefully. Pay attention to wagering requirements, game restrictions, and expiry dates.

Navigating the Games: A Beginner’s Guide
Online casinos offer a vast array of games. Here’s a brief overview of some popular choices:
- Pokies (Slots): These are the most popular games, known for their simplicity and exciting gameplay. They come in various themes and offer different features, such as bonus rounds and free spins.
- Blackjack: A classic card game where the goal is to beat the dealer by getting a hand value as close to 21 as possible without exceeding it.
- Roulette: A game of chance where you bet on where a ball will land on a spinning wheel.
- Poker: Several variations are available, including Texas Hold’em and Omaha. Poker involves skill and strategy, requiring players to build strong hands and outsmart their opponents.
- Baccarat: A card game where players bet on the outcome of a hand between the player and the banker.
Start with games with simpler rules and lower stakes to familiarize yourself with the gameplay. Many casinos offer free play or demo versions of their games, allowing you to practice without risking real money.
Responsible Gambling: Playing Smart
Responsible gambling is crucial for a positive online casino experience. Here are some essential tips:
- Set a Budget: Determine how much you’re willing to spend and stick to it. Never chase losses.
- Set Time Limits: Decide how much time you’ll spend gambling and take regular breaks.
- Avoid Gambling Under the Influence: Never gamble when you’re under the influence of alcohol or drugs.
- Know When to Stop: If you’re no longer enjoying the experience or feel like you’re losing control, take a break or stop playing altogether.
- Utilize Self-Exclusion Tools: Most casinos offer self-exclusion options, allowing you to temporarily or permanently restrict your access to the platform.
- Seek Help if Needed: If you’re struggling with problem gambling, reach out to support organizations like Gambling Help Online or Lifeline.
Payment Methods: Depositing and Withdrawing Funds
Online casinos offer various payment methods for depositing and withdrawing funds. Popular options for Australian players include:
- Credit/Debit Cards: Visa and Mastercard are widely accepted.
- Bank Transfers: A secure method, but processing times can vary.
- E-wallets: PayPal, Neteller, and Skrill offer fast and convenient transactions.
- Prepaid Cards: Paysafecard provides an anonymous way to deposit funds.
- Cryptocurrencies: Some casinos accept c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in.
Always check the casino’s terms and conditions regarding payment methods, including fees, processing times, and withdrawal limits.
